Transaction 3b39e189b2da1fe18e385ff41f7c0e3949766a10501ab689a8d3ae3da7b8cea7
1 Input
1 Output
-
3b39e189b2da1fe18e385ff41f7c0e3949766a10501ab689a8d3ae3da7b8cea7:0
- value
- 3143642
- script pubkey
- OP_0 OP_PUSHBYTES_20 02d1bac9f72bf45d203f1ee115aab4b077805a3d
- address
- bc1qqtgm4j0h90696gplrms3t245kpmcqk3aeqyk2x